For instance, this taxonomic change cut up Rhipidura fuliginosa into Rhipidura albiscapa and Rhipidura fuliginosa, but the older, broader concept of Rhipidura fuliginosa has a different taxon id (8161) than the newer, narrower idea with the same name (244276). So when making a taxonomic split or merge, ensure you first make a model new taxon if needed. If the model new taxon bears the same name as an existing taxon, you will need to mark the prevailing one as "inactive" before the system will allow you to create the brand new one. Interestingly, in the course of the Roman Empire, the term curatores referred to officers holding positions of duty and authority. Civil servants, or curatores, were held accountable for the empire's roads, river site visitors, public video games, festivals, and public items. In fact, the function of this "caretaker" was extremely intertwined with that of the built surroundings in the course of the Roman Empire, interacting with the city on totally different scales to make sure its viability for all.

Allele sequences could additionally be generated utilizing numerous completely different sequencing applied sciences. The sequences should already be trimmed to the appropriate start/end websites of the locus by the submitter, and it's the position of the curator to guarantee that this has been done correctly. You can examine towards current alleles to verify utilizing the hyperlinks offered throughout the curator's interface. Depending on the sequencing know-how, you may have to examine the standard of the info.

Submitters might ship new combos of present alleles for ST definition. Most databases require that each new ST assigned has consultant isolate data obtainable so a separate isolate submission must be made to the isolate database at the similar time. The curator ought to ensure that this isolate information has been submitted before defining the model new ST. No other checks are usually required. Sequences decided by Sanger/dideoxy terminator sequencing require that forward and reverse hint recordsdata (files ending with .ab1/.scf) are submitted.

The curator is required to assemble these and check that the submitted sequence is supported by the trace files. The sequence query database instruments (linked directly from the submission interface) can be utilized to determine which nucleotides differ from the most related present allele, so it ought to be specifically checked that the 2 traces are unambiguous at these positions. If hint recordsdata are of poor high quality or don't cover the full length of the allele then the sequence ought to be rejected.

In the early 1800s, Baron Dominique Vivant Denon was the first director of the world-renowned Louvre Museum. He inherited a significant extra of art beneath Napoleon's rule, an amount that would not fill the huge salons of the museum.
